I have been entranced with taking photographs since the young age of fourteen
when I possessed a Brownie Box camera which I proudly took on the family trip
to Europe. There I captured my first castle turrets and Roman ruins in black & white.
I worked in black and white exclusively for the first fifteen years, well into my twenties.
My twenties, in Marin in the late sixties and seventies provided a series of bathroom apartment darkrooms, making simply the brushing of teeth a challenge at times. I focused then on fine art
images and portraits in black and white.
In the seventies I was deeply involved in life on the waterfront and became a marine photographer chronicling classic wooden boats of all types from Vancouver to San Diego, collecting images in harbors of every size with the passion of a diligent detective. I spent several years in and around
the California commercial fishing industry and enjoyed photography of the characters that
populated it, as well as it's vessels. I also shot in color then.
1976 took me to family life in Sonoma County where I began a now twenty three year love affair with the Chosen Landscape. My goal is to make and share images that are quintessentially
California, for those who know this land.
Sales work for my greeting card company Nautilus Productions, has also taken me to regions the state over and along the back roads of California, where I am at peace with my camera, always seeking the magical light.
